    How aging affects hearing and mental sharpness

    As we age, our bodies undergo a variety of changes, and two of the most significant areas affected are hearing and mental acuity. These changes can have profound implications on our overall quality of life, impacting communication, relationships, and daily functioning. Understanding how aging affects hearing and mental sharpness is essential for older adults and their caregivers to devise strategies for maintaining cognitive and auditory health.

    Hearing loss is one of the most common sensory deficits in the aging population, with studies indicating that nearly one-third of individuals aged 65 and older experience hearing difficulties. The process of aging naturally leads to a decline in auditory function, often beginning with higher frequencies. This phenomenon, known as presbycusis, results from changes in the inner ear structures, damage from environmental noise exposure over the years, and even changes in the auditory nerve pathways that transmit sound information to the brain.

    The implications of hearing loss extend beyond simply struggling to hear conversations or appreciating music. It can lead to social isolation, increased feelings of anxiety and depression, and cognitive decline. The connection between hearing loss and cognitive decline is an area of increasing research interest. Several studies suggest that individuals with untreated hearing loss are at a higher risk of developing dementia compared to those with normal hearing. The cognitive load of trying to understand muffled speech or filtering out background noise strains the brain, which can impede cognitive resources that could otherwise support memory and decision-making.

    On the other hand, mental sharpness, which encompasses cognitive functions like memory, attention, and problem-solving capabilities, is also subject to the aging process. Cognitive aging varies significantly from individual to individual, with some people experiencing minor changes while others may face significant challenges. Factors such as genetics, lifestyle choices, and overall health can influence how well cognitive functions hold up with age.

    Research has shown that while some cognitive abilities, such as vocabulary and general knowledge, may remain stable or even improve with age, others, like processing speed, working memory, and executive function often decline. This decline can make it more challenging to learn new information, adapt to changing situations, or manage daily tasks.

    Interestingly, engaging in mentally stimulating activities, maintaining social connections, and staying physically active can protect against cognitive decline. Activities such as reading, puzzles, and games, as well as continuous learning through classes or workshops, can keep the mind sharp. Likewise, regular physical exercise promotes blood flow to the brain, supporting neuroplasticity, which is the brain’s ability to adapt and grow.

    The interplay between hearing health and cognitive function is significant. When individuals have difficulty hearing, they may withdraw from social interactions, leading to fewer opportunities for mental engagement and cognitive stimulation. Conversely, maintaining good hearing health through regular screenings and the use of hearing aids can help preserve both social connections and cognitive abilities. Recent advancements in hearing technology, including smart hearing aids that connect to smartphones and offer various sound settings, can make a marked difference in how well older adults interact with the world around them.

    How inflammation contributes to skin aging and nail damage

    Inflammation is a natural response of the body to injury or infection, playing a crucial role in healing processes. However, when inflammation becomes chronic, it can have detrimental effects on various organs, including the skin and nails. Understanding how inflammation contributes to skin aging and nail damage is crucial for maintaining a youthful appearance and healthy nails.

    The skin is the body’s largest organ and acts as a barrier against external threats. Chronic inflammation leads to a cascade of biological responses that can impair the skin’s integrity. One of the primary mechanisms through which inflammation accelerates skin aging is the increased production of free radicals. These reactive molecules can damage collagen, elastin, and other essential proteins that provide structure and elasticity to the skin. Over time, the cumulative effect of this oxidative stress results in fine lines, wrinkles, and sagging skin.

    In addition to free radicals, inflammatory processes stimulate the production of pro-inflammatory cytokines. These small signaling proteins can disrupt the skin’s natural balance by promoting the breakdown of its structural components. With an imbalance in cellular signaling, the skin may lose its ability to repair itself effectively. This deterioration further accelerates the aging process, leading to a dull, uneven complexion and diminishing skin tone.

    Furthermore, chronic inflammation has a significant impact on skin barrier function. The skin barrier consists of lipid layers that protect against environmental assaults and prevent water loss. When inflammation disrupts the barrier, it can lead to conditions like eczema or psoriasis, which are marked by redness, irritation, and excessive dryness. These conditions not only make the skin appear older but can also foster an environment for further inflammation, creating a vicious cycle that exacerbates skin aging.

    Nail health is equally susceptible to the effects of inflammation. The nails are constructed from keratin, a tough protein that shields the underlying nail bed from trauma and infection. Inflammatory conditions such as psoriasis or onycholysis (the separation of the nail from the nail bed) can arise from chronic inflammation. These conditions lead to nail deformities, discoloration, and even pain, significantly impacting one’s confidence and overall aesthetic.

    Moreover, inflammation can hinder the growth cycle of nails. Healthy nails require a balance of moisture, nutrients, and proper blood flow. Chronic inflammation can restrict circulation in the nail matrix, where new nail cells are produced. This reduced blood flow can slow nail growth and compromise nail strength, leading to brittleness and breakage.

    Inflammation can also be triggered by lifestyle factors such as poor diet, stress, and exposure to environmental toxins. Diets high in processed foods and sugars contribute to inflammation, while stress triggers cortisol release, which also plays a role in inflammatory responses in the body. By managing these lifestyle factors, individuals can mitigate inflammation, thereby promoting healthier skin and nails.
